Firefighters struggling to contain Jonkershoek inferno

Reading Time: < 1 minute

The fire in the valley below Jonkershoek at Stellenbosch in the Cape Winelands District is proving challenging.

Municipal spokesperson, Jo-Anne Otto, says the firefighting teams have reported repeated flare-ups that are difficult to bring under control due to the hot weather.

She says they focused their attention on managing the fire during the relative cool of the night.

Otto says two of the firefighters have been hurt.

“The two ground team members that were injured during the night have sustained serious and will be transferred to specialist facilities for further care.

Our prayer accompanies them. There has been no loss of life, livelihood, or infrastructure,” she adds.
